1. Install "g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free.x86_64" package
Here is a brief guide to show you how to install g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free.x86_64 on Fedora 35
$
sudo dnf update
Copied
$
sudo dnf install
g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free.x86_64
Copied
2. Uninstall "g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free.x86_64" package
Please follow the step by step instructions below to uninstall g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free.x86_64 on Fedora 35:
$
sudo dnf remove
g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free.x86_64
Copied
$
sudo dnf autoremove
Copied
3. Information about the g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free.x86_64 package on Fedora 35
Last metadata expiration check: 2:04:48 ago on Wed Sep 7 08:25:01 2022.
Available Packages
Name : g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free
Version : 1.20.0
Release : 1.fc35
Architecture : x86_64
Size : 102 k
Source : gstreamer1-plugins-ugly-free-1.20.0-1.fc35.src.rpm
Repository : updates
Summary : GStreamer streaming media framework "ugly" plugins
URL : http://gstreamer.freedesktop.org/
License : LGPLv2+ and LGPLv2
Description : GStreamer is a streaming media framework, based on graphs of elements which
: operate on media data.
:
: This package contains plug-ins whose license is not fully compatible with LGPL.
